簡體   English   中英

如何在Rails 4和Nginx中執行杠桿式瀏覽器緩存?

[英]How to perform leverage browser caching in rails 4 and nginx?

在我的Web應用程序中,我有一個網頁https://www.dockettech.com/rental-agreement 。我需要對該頁面執行杠桿式瀏覽器緩存。當通過頁面速度運行它時,它引發以下指令:

Leverage browser caching for the following cacheable resources:
https://connect.facebook.net/en_US/fbevents.js (20 minutes)
https://js-agent.newrelic.com/nr-971.min.js (60 minutes)
https://www.google-analytics.com/analytics.js (2 hours)

我的Web應用程序在Nginx服務器上運行,並托管在Amazon AWS上。 我是新手開發人員。任何幫助將不勝感激

該消息告訴您,這些JavaScript文件帶有標頭,這些標頭將它們標記為僅可在短時間內緩存:例如,如果您的訪問者每天僅訪問該網站一次,則它們每次都會請求這些資產。 如果為資產提供了一個月的緩存生存期,則這種情況的發生頻率會降低。

但是,您不提供資產,因此無法更改其緩存到期時間。 幾乎可以肯定沒關系。 所有這3個都相當普遍-即使您的用戶不經常訪問您的網站,也很可能他們最近使用足以訪問他們的那些庫訪問了該網站。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M